Definitions ACS NTDB National Trauma Data Standard: Data Dictionary 2024Admissions (“NTDS”) – A Web20 apr. 2024 · In 2007, the National Trauma Data Standard (NTDS) was created through a consensus of multiple stakeholders [ 14 ]. The NTDS specified which fields needed to be collected, the field structure, and how the field is defined, and provided a source hierarchy indicating where the fields should be captured from the medical record.

A local or state registry may collect both a “patient’s home city” and “patient’s home ZIP code,” but the NTDS requires one or the other. A mapping program may ensure only one variable is submitted to the NTDB.
